Metropolitan Museum, Manila

Metropolitan Museum, Manila

If you are an admirer of contemporary and modern art then a visit to the Metropolitan Museum is a must. Also known as the Met, the Museum is located with the Bangko Sentral ng Pilipinas, in Manila. Deemed as the finest Museum portraying modern and contemporary art, the Met has earned its reputation not only in the country but is also a growing name in the world arena.

Established in 1976, the Museum initially exhibited only foreign artists. It has been associated with names like Picasso, Walter Gropius, Paul Klee etc. By 1986, over 100 non Philippine art exhibits had been showcased via this brilliant Museum. With growing awareness and appreciation for the world of art, soon Manila started brewing with local artists, eager to display their own creation to the country and the world. Soon the foreign exhibits were complemented with the works of Philippine artists. Apart from being a very happening gallery and museum, the Met is also an excellent place to catch up on some art lessons. With the slogan of ‘Art for all’, the Met Museum has introduced Braille captions near its displays and also provides bilingual audio guides so that none of its visitors miss out on the art on display.
